The Anello di Monte Pennarossa route traverses 5.4 miles through Terni, Umbria, Italia. Elevation gain totals 1,451 feet, with 496 feet of descent. The most significant ascent covers 1.6 miles and gains 658 feet. Vertical rate measures 269 feet of gain per mile. About 58% of the distance is runnable terrain. Terrain is predominantly trail. Technical difficulty: very hilly. This route ranks at the 80.63th percentile for difficulty among similar distances.
